top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

              区块链多节点存储系统的大揭秘:你需要知道的

              • 2026-05-21 08:19:32

              区块链存储,为什么要选择多节点?

              大家好,今天咱们聊聊区块链这个话题。相信不少朋友对区块链有了初步的了解,但如果说到多节点存储系统,可能还有些陌生。别担心,今天我就带大家深入探讨一下这个话题!

              首先,我们得知道,区块链的核心就是“去中心化”。传统的数据存储系统一般都是在一个中心化的服务器上,比如你用的云存储。有时候,如果这个服务器出问题,那你所有的数据可能就会全部丢失,甚至泄露。但多节点存储系统可就不一样了,它就像是把数据放在很多个小房间里,万一有一个房间坏了,其他房间的数据还是安全的。

              多节点存储系统的基本原理

              那么多节点存储系统是如何运作的呢?简单来说,它会把数据切割成小块,然后将这些小块分散存储到各个节点上。就像我们把一份蛋糕切成很多小块,然后分别放到不同的盘子里。这样,即使其中一个盘子掉了,其他盘子的蛋糕块还是可以吃的!

              在这样的系统中,每个节点都有自己的数据副本。这种冗余会提高数据的安全性和可用性。当你需要获取某些数据时,系统会自动从多个节点中调取,确保你能最快的速度拿到数据。这种方式的优势不言而喻,降低了单点故障的风险。

              有哪些知名的多节点存储系统呢?

              现在,我们来看看一些具体的多节点存储系统。这里给大家介绍几个比较知名的。

              1. **IPFS(InterPlanetary File System)** 这是一种分布式文件存储系统,可以理解成是网络的“云盘”。在IPFS中,每个文件都被分成若干个小块,存储在不同的节点上。当你需要下载文件时,系统会从多个节点同时下载。这种方法大大提高了下载速度,更重要的是,数据是不可篡改的,一旦存储在区块链上,就无法被动用。听说不少科技公司和去中心化项目都开始使用IPFS了,很赞的选择!

              2. **BigchainDB** 这个项目将区块链和数据库的优点结合在一起,是一种去中心化的数据库。它不仅能存储数据,还有高吞吐量的能力,主要用来处理大量的交易。BigchainDB允许用户在每个节点上存储自己数据的副本,甚至提供了完整的API,开发者只需几行代码就能构建自己的去中心化应用。

              3. **Sia** 又是一个非常有趣的项目。Sia是个去中心化的云存储平台,用户可以把自己的闲置硬盘空间租给需要存储的人,双方通过智能合约来确保交易的安全与公开。这样一来,普通用户也能参与数据存储,赚点小钱。而这些数据以加密的方式存储在网络上,因此安全性也大大提升。

              多节点存储的优势分析

              既然聊到了这些系统,咱们再来讲讲多节点存储的优势。首先是安全性,正如之前提到的,可以避免单点故障问题。万一某个节点被攻击或者掉线,其他节点依旧能正常工作,数据安全得到了很好的保障。

              其次是数据的隐私性。因为数据散布在不同的节点上,单纯的攻击者很难获取整个数据集。这就像把自己隐私信息藏在不同的地方,而不是放在一个显眼的地方。

              再说说可扩展性。随着数据量的增加,多节点存储系统可以很方便地增加更多节点来提高存储能力,没有太多复杂的步骤,这对于快速扩展的企业来说,简直太重要了。

              使用多节点存储的挑战

              不过,尽管好处很多,但多节点存储也并非没有挑战。最大的挑战之一就是节点之间的数据一致性问题。因为数据分布在不同的节点,如何确保每个节点的数据都是一致且更新的,这可是一门学问。

              此外,网络延迟也是一个问题。假设某个节点由于网络原因无法及时响应,那用户的请求就可能会受到影响。为了保证系统的高可用性,开发者必须在设计时考虑到这些潜在的问题。

              我个人的看法与体验

              作为一名普通用户,我也体会到了去中心化存储带来的便利。有一次,我在网上看到一个关于IPFS的应用,想尝试一下。这种感觉就像打破了藏在桌子底下的“隐私箱”,所有的数据变得透明又安全。尤其是在传输重要文件时,能感受到那种贴心与安心。

              而且,我记得我一朋友是程序员,他告诉我,使用BigchainDB开发去中心化应用的过程非常流畅,API简单易用,让他省了不少心。科技的发展真的是让人觉得兴奋啊!

              未来展望

              展望未来,我觉得多节点存储系统的应用会越来越广泛。随着技术的进步,大家对数据安全和隐私的重视程度越来越高。这种去中心化的方式无疑是解决这些问题的一个方向。而且,随着越来越多的企业开始拥抱区块链技术,多节点存储的应用场景也会变得越来越多元化,真是让人期待啊!

              所以,如果你还在犹豫要不要深入了解区块链和多节点存储,建议你试试看。或许在不久的将来,你就会发现自己的很多担忧和困惑都能够通过这种技术得到解决。希望今天的分享能让你对多节点存储系统有更清晰的认识,别忘了把这些知识分享给你的朋友哦!

              • Tags
              • 区块链,多节点存储,数据安全,去中心化